The RP2040 has no internal flash. The therefore includes a dedicated section for an external QSPI flash chip (typically a W25Q16JV or GD25Q16C , 2MB to 16MB in size). ydrp2040 schematic

The YD-RP2040 is often preferred in schematics for custom PCBs because it breaks out the pins more conveniently than the original Pico. This allows for easier debugging using a second Pico or a dedicated debugger like the CMSIS-DAP. Additionally, the inclusion of a Reset (RST) button on the board layout (connected to the RUN pin in the schematic) eliminates the need to unplug the USB cable to restart code execution.
